Longford Women’s Link to hold ‘WELCOME DigitALL’ event

LWL

Longford Women's Link is holding a ‘WELCOME DigitALL’ event this Friday

To mark International Women’s Day 2023, Longford Women’s Link is hosting ‘WELCOME DigitALL’ this Friday, March 10 from 11am to 2pm in the LWL training building.

The event title ‘WELCOME DigitALL’ highlights the United Nations (UN) observances theme (DigitALL: Innovation and Technology for Gender Equality) and it also celebrates LWL’s contributions and achievements in this field, their encouragement of Female digital entrepreneurship and their involvement at European level on the DELSA project.

Siona Cahill will be speaking at the event and it promises to be an enjoyable event with some creative activities and a session of mindfulness planned, a day for all women living in County Longford to take time out, come together, share their stories and celebrate.
